Features of Denison’s Crime Map
The crime map provides several helpful features to understand local safety:
- Crime Categories: Different crime types such as theft, vandalism, and assault are color-coded for easy identification.
- Time Filters: View data from specific periods to analyze trends over time.
- Heat Maps: Visualize areas with higher concentrations of criminal activity.
- Details on Incidents: Click on map points to get detailed information about each crime, including date and type.

Safety Tips for Denison Residents
While crime maps are valuable tools, personal vigilance is key. Consider these safety tips:
- Stay Informed: Regularly check the crime map and local news updates.
- Report Suspicious Activity: Contact Denison police if you notice anything unusual.
- Community Involvement: Participate in neighborhood watch programs and community safety initiatives.
- Secure Property: Lock doors, install security cameras, and keep valuables out of sight.
